Banana Chocolate Cream Pie Recipe
- 3/4 c. sugar
- 1/4 c. cornstarch
- 1/4 c. plus 1 Tbsp. cocoa pwdr
- 1/4 tsp salt
- 2 c. lowfat milk
- 2 x egg yolks, beaten
- 1 tsp vanilla extract
- 3 x bananas, sliced, divided
- 1 x prepared (8-inch) graham cracker pie crust
- 1/2 c. whipping cream
- Mix the sugar, cornstarch, 1/4 c. cocoa and salt in top of a double boiler.
- Blend in 1/2 c. lowfat milk and yolks; stir till smooth.
- Stir in the remaining lowfat milk.
- Cook cocoa mix over boiling water, stirring continually, till thickened (about 5 min).
- Remove from heat.
- Stir in vanilla.
- Cold slightly.
- Arrange a third of banana slices in piecrust.
- Spoon half the chocolate mix over bananas.
- Repeat layering; cover loosely.
- Chill for 15 min.
- Beat the cream with an electric mixer set at high speed till soft peaks form, about 5 min.
- Top each serving with whipped cream.
- Garnish with remaining banana slices and cocoa.
- Servings: 6.
